I have been a forum lurker for a while now and I just have to say how awesome so many of you are! So many of you are such an inspiration.
A little about me? I am 38 and up to a few months ago I spent a large portion of my day sitting on my butt. It wasn't due to sheer laziness completely, I have been dealing with a few medical issues for quite a few years. I was truly at the point where I was out of breath doing very simple tasks. I slipped two discs in my back and was waiting on surgery for fibroid tumours. I was smoking on average 25/30 cigarettes a day.
After I started to heal from slipping two discs, dosed up on pain medications for both my back and painful knees (I was also told I had arthritis in my spine) I knew enough was enough. I was miserable!
First thing to go was the smoking. I knew if I could do that I could do anything! Next came my hysterectomy for the fibroids. 17 tumours were removed in total. During my healing time I gained even more weight, I was so unhappy. Finally I got the ok from my surgeon to start exercising. I will remember my first attempt for the rest of my life. I hopped onto my treadmill, slowly increased the speed until it hit 2 kilometres an hour - OMG 10 minutes later I felt like I was going to die!! Lol
Fast forward to today, this morning for the second day in a row I completed the full 'The Biggest Loser Last Chance Workout' - a total kick *kitten* 60 minute workout.
For the first time in a long time I am pain medication free. I still have trouble with my knees and I have to be careful with my back but geez I feel a million dollars compared to the sad, unhealthy, smoking, dosed up not even living person I used to be.
